Medical Providers Group: Building community and preventing burnout

Those in the medical field carry a unique and overwhelming load that often leads to feelings of loneliness, anxiety and burnout. Harbor Christian Counseling is excited to be running a group specifically for Medical Providers. The purpose of this group is to provide support and resources to navigate the unique challenges of working in a particularly stressful and demanding field. In a virtual group setting, participants will be provided with burnout prevention strategies, tools to process and navigate second-hand trauma, and practical ways to integrate faith and the gospel not only in serving patients but in building peer support amidst a challenging and competitive work environment.

 

ABOUT THE GROUP

  • OVERVIEW: Group participants will gain a clearer understanding of burnout, compassion fatigue, and secondary trauma within the medical field, learn and practice practical coping strategies that are realistic within demanding healthcare environments, develop healthier boundaries at work and at home to support long-term sustainability, and process their experiences while integrating faith and vocation alongside peers who understand the unique pressures of medicine.

  • WHO:  Medical providers in Massachusetts, including nurses and physicians, ages 18+. The group will be limited to 6–8 participants in order to provide a safe, confidential, and engaging group experience for all. The group will be led from an integrative Christian counseling perspective, thoughtfully incorporating a biblical worldview around work, rest, suffering, and service. Participants of all faith backgrounds are welcome to join.

  • WHEN:  Thursday evenings, 5:30–6:30 pm (EST), from March 26th through April 30th (six sessions total). For best results, participants are encouraged to attend all six sessions.

  • WHERE:  For accessibility reasons, this group will meet remotely via Zoom for all group sessions.

  • COST:  $50 per group session (total of $300 for full group).
